Issue descriptionpackage build failing on chromium.gpu/GPU Win Builder Builders failed on: - GPU Win Builder: https://build.chromium.org/p/chromium.gpu/builders/GPU%20Win%20Builder I've seen three instances of this today, in each case it looks like the upload to cloud storage is interrupted (following is an example from of the log files): ... Uploading ...n32_e5e63e607292ffc1bc65e35ee52f2612d462ee27.zip: 336.07 MiB/1.09 GiB Uploading ...n32_e5e63e607292ffc1bc65e35ee52f2612d462ee27.zip: 352.08 MiB/1.09 GiB I don't see any other log info related to the transfer so it seems like the job is being cancelled.

Looks like 1h buildbot timeout: command timed out: 3600 seconds elapsed, attempting to kill program finished with exit code 1 elapsedTime=3600.227000 I'm not sure why upload is so slow though. It jumped from several minutes to >40min. Seems it affects both 'isolate' and 'package build' steps, so it's unlikely it is something on Isolate server side.
